GreenPosting Food Writer Jared Goodman Introduction
2/17/2010

To the green people of Portland and beyond, let me introduce myself. My name is Jared Goodman, and I will be the food writer for GreenPosting.

Every month I’ll be reporting on Portland’s bustling food scene. But rather than saturate the pool of food critics and the like, I’ll investigate, explore, engage, challenge, dissect and discuss the politics of food here in Portland. Though, before I extrapolate on the future endeavors of this monthly posting, it’d be good for you to know a bit more about me and my relationship with food.

Among close friends and family, it’s a known fact that I didn’t eat any fruits or vegetables until my early twenties. Not only that, but I denied myself foods with unrevealed ingredients. I refused ethnic food - be it Mexican, Indian, Thai, Ethiopian, etc. For years of college I strictly followed the all-American diet of hamburgers and pizza. (Burgers consisted of meat, bun and ketchup.) Forget organic, let alone nutritious. Food was nothing more than a means to an end.

Looking back now, it’s hard to pinpoint the beginning of my metamorphosis. Years ago I migrated West from East and developed an appreciation for alternative diets, holistic medicine and environmental sustainability. A couple years later I was living in Minneapolis and preaching the good word of local foods. Come June 1st 2008, I committed myself to a strict 100-mile diet for one year. As a locavore and burgeoning dogmatist, my passion for critical food literacy and food justice was born.

Fast forward again and I’m in Portland, planting the seed for a career in food. I read, write, think food. Food justice. Food politics. Food security. Good food. Real food. Local food. Whole food. I teach families critical food literacy and basic cooking skills. I consult households on meal planning strategies, and of course, I have a blog, Good-Man-Eats, to document these ever-evolving food projects and ideas.

This newest development - writing for GreenPosting.org - will be fabulous. Expect articles on food policy in Portland, community gardens, the 100-mile diet, farmer’s markets and the occasional interview with local sustainable businesses. I encourage discussion and debate. Please  share ideas, criticisms, and comment if need be. This is the beginning of something great. I promise.
